Rediscover William Morrisâ(TM)s enchanting narrative poem, âAtalanta's Race And The Proud King, From The Earthly Paradise [pt.1]â, a masterful blend of classical mythology and Victorian verse. This edition offers readers a unique opportunity to delve into the rich tapestry of Morris's storytelling, where the swift-footed Atalanta challenges suitors in a race with her life as the prize, and a proud king's destiny unfolds against a backdrop of earthly delights and human ambition.
Expertly edited with an insightful introduction and comprehensive notes, this volume illuminates the historical and literary context of Morris's work, revealing the influences of classical literature and the Pre-Raphaelite movement. Experience the enduring beauty and timeless themes of love, fate, and the pursuit of happiness that define âThe Earthly Paradiseâ. Perfect for students, scholars, and lovers of classic poetry, this edition brings Morris's vision to life for a new generation.
